Cow Signals Series: The Most Practical Books

The Cow Signals series represents some of the most widely-used guides worldwide. These exceptional books teach farmers to systematically read cow behavior. They also help interpret posture changes and appetite patterns. Learning to recognize these signals enables better nutrition management. Additionally, it improves care protocols and housing design.

Cow Signals: From Calf to Heifer


From Calf to Heifer book on calf rearing

Raising healthy calves into productive heifers is a major investment. This essential guide explains the principles of successful calf rearing. It covers comprehensive risk management and daily care routines. Moreover, it supports efficient growth rates and production potential.

Hoof Signals


Hoof Signals book on hoof health

Hoof health directly impacts feed intake levels and overall cow comfort. It also affects reproductive fertility rates and milk production. This crucial guide explains how to integrate hoof care into daily routines. Furthermore, it covers implementing effective preventive measures.

Udder Health (Cow Signals Series)

by Jan Hulsen and Theo Lam


Udder Health book on mastitis prevention

Maintaining optimal udder health requires consistent routines. Proper milking procedures are essential. Effective prevention strategies matter too. This highly practical guide helps you organize work protocols systematically. Consequently, it solves common challenges like elevated cell counts.

Feeding Signals


Feeding Signals book on nutrition management

This is among the most valuable guides for nutrition management. It answers critical practical questions through concise explanations. Extensive real-farm photography illustrates key concepts. This comprehensive book addresses four essential feeding questions:

  1. What should I feed and in what quantities?
  2. How can I ensure every animal gets the right ration?
  3. How do I verify that every animal is eating properly?
  4. How do I adjust and troubleshoot feeding problems?

Cow Signals


Cow Signals book on reading cow behavior

The foundational guide on cow behavior observation teaches systematic interpretation. Farmers learn to observe behavior patterns and posture changes. They also identify physical health indicators. It structures observation around three essential questions: What do I see? Why did this happen? What does it mean? This proven approach supports better daily decisions.
